When it comes to purchasing tickets, Shepherd's Bush station offers convenient options. The ticket office is open from 07:30 to 18:30, Monday to Friday, with reduced hours on weekends. If you're more tech-savvy, ticket machines are aplenty and accessible to all. Collected your tickets online? No problem! Simply head to any ticket machine to pick them up.
While the station boasts step-free access throughout, there are no waiting rooms or accessible toilets available—yet, staff assistance is at your beck and call, ensuring all travelers are cared for. CCTV cameras are installed for added security.
Shepherd's Bush doesn't just connect you with train services; it seamlessly integrates with London's robust transport system. The station is a short two-minute walk from Shepherd's Bush Underground Station on the Central Line. Local buses and rail replacement services also operate nearby, making it easy for you to reach other spots in the city. For journey planning, printable information is just a click here.

Old Roan station is equipped with a staffed ticket office open from 05:48 to 00:13 daily and from 08:13 on Sundays. While it doesn’t have ticket machines, you can collect online-purchased tickets directly from the office. The station is also mindful of accessibility, offering step-free access via lifts and ramps, making it easy for passengers with mobility challenges to navigate the station. An induction loop is available for those using hearing aids.
For assistance, the staff is ready to help throughout the week, including weekends, and customer information screens are available to keep you updated on your train departure and arrival times. Safety is prioritized with CCTV coverage on-site. However, note that Old Roan station lacks certain amenities like refreshment facilities, ATMs, and shops, so it might be wise to purchase snacks or withdraw cash before arriving at the station.
If you're considering onward travel options, though there isn’t a taxi rank at Old Roan, various bus services connect you to nearby regions. For more information on schedules and services, you can contact Traveline or check the Merseytravel website. If you're flying via Liverpool John Lennon Airport, you can purchase combined train and bus tickets, making it seamless to continue your journey from the station to the airport with routes like the 86A or 80A bus.
